A free app for Android, by Pratik Raut.

Power Menu is a very useful application that can help you in two different ways. If your device has a broken or non-working power button, this app can help you to fix it, while if your device has a broken power button, this app can help you to restart your device without having to do any other thing.

The first thing that you need to do is to download this app and install it. You will be able to see the menu on your screen. If you want to know what options are available, you need to tap on the information area.
